It wasn't a meat-and-potatoes policy speech, but the 600-plus people who filled a riverfront restaurant got what they came for from Mitt Romney.

He gave a shout out to mothers, said he likes oil, natural gas, coal and nuclear energy, deplored the federal debt and pledged to balance the budget.

He even gave a nod to the Keystone XL pipeline, which he said he would approve.

Romney, the presumptive GOP presidential nominee, received an enthusiastic response from the crowd at Rick's Cafe Boatyard, some of whom had waited nearly three hours for the 12-minute speech.
